Exploring Wayanad: A Family-Friendly 3-Day Itinerary

Monday, October 16: Arrival in Wayanad

Welcome to Wayanad! Begin your adventure by checking in to your accommodation and freshening up. In the morning, visit the Edakkal Caves, a fascinating natural wonder with ancient rock carvings. Explore the caves and learn about their historical and archaeological significance. After a delicious lunch, head to the Wayanad Wildlife Sanctuary for an exciting wildlife safari. Spot elephants, deer, and various bird species as you explore the lush greenery. In the evening, take a leisurely walk around the beautiful Pookode Lake, known for its serene surroundings and boating opportunities.

  • Edakkal Caves: Estimated cost - INR 50 per person, Estimated time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Wayanad Wildlife Sanctuary: Estimated cost - INR 250 per person, Estimated time spent - 3-4 hours
  • Pookode Lake: Estimated cost - INR 10 per person, Estimated time spent - 1-2 hours
Tuesday, October 17: Nature and Culture Exploration

Embrace nature's beauty with a visit to the breathtaking Soochipara Waterfalls in the morning. Enjoy a refreshing dip in the cool waters or simply marvel at the cascading falls. Afterward, make your way to the charming Meenmutty Waterfalls, located amidst lush forests. Don't forget to carry a picnic lunch to enjoy amidst nature. In the afternoon, immerse yourself in the rich cultural heritage of Wayanad by visiting the Wayanad Heritage Museum. Discover artifacts, tribal relics, and traditional handicrafts that showcase the region's history. Complete your day with a visit to the stunning Kanthanpara Waterfalls, known for its picturesque beauty.

  • Soochipara Waterfalls: Estimated cost - INR 80 per person, Estimated time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Meenmutty Waterfalls: Estimated cost - INR 30 per person, Estimated time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Wayanad Heritage Museum: Estimated cost - INR 20 per person, Estimated time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Kanthanpara Waterfalls: Estimated cost - INR 10 per person, Estimated time spent - 1-2 hours
Wednesday, October 18: Adventure and Tea Plantations

Prepare for an adventurous day! Start with a thrilling trek to the Chembra Peak, the highest peak in Wayanad. Enjoy panoramic views of the surrounding mountains and the heart-shaped lake atop the peak. Remember to obtain necessary permits for the trek in advance. After an energizing morning, visit the picturesque Banasura Sagar Dam. Take a boat ride on the tranquil reservoir and soak in the stunning surroundings. In the afternoon, explore the aromatic tea plantations at the Meppadi Tea Factory and learn about the tea-making process. To culminate your Wayanad trip, savor a magical sunset at the beautiful Karapuzha Dam.

  • Chembra Peak Trek: Estimated cost - INR 750 per person (includes guide and permit), Estimated time spent - 4-5 hours
  • Banasura Sagar Dam: Estimated cost - INR 10 per person (boating charges extra), Estimated time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Meppadi Tea Factory: Estimated cost - INR 20 per person (includes tea tasting), Estimated time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Karapuzha Dam: Free entry, Estimated time spent - 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Wayanad, make sure to visit the Muthanga Wildlife Sanctuary, a lesser-known gem where you can spot rare wildlife species like tigers, leopards, and langurs. Also, don't miss the chance to try the traditional Malabar cuisine at local restaurants. Some must-try dishes include Malabar biryani, appam with stew, and banana chips. Engage with the friendly locals and learn about their culture and traditions, such as the fascinating Theyyam performances which showcase vibrant costumes and captivating dance forms.
